Another week is upon us and the numbers are rolling in. Kinda. A couple new releases dropped last week and are sitting up top despite the small numbers. Raheem DeVaughn moved 45K while DJ Khaled sold 25K. Sade is still sitting pretty in the number 2 slot and Black Eye Peas are in number 8. Check the top.
Top 200 Album Sales (Top 5 Hip Hop/R&B)
| Rank | Artist | Album | This Week | Est. Total |
| 2 | Sade | Soldier Of Love |
79,000 | 899,000 |
| 8 | Black Eyed Peas | The E.N.D. |
46,000 | 2,228,000 |
| 9 | Raheem DeVaugn | The Love & War Masterpeace | 45,000 | 45,000 |
| 12 | Lil Wayne | Rebirth |
32,000 | 393,000 |
| 14 | DJ Khaled | Victory |
28,000 | 28,000 |
